What have you done to keep yourself from falling back into that life?
We have put God first in every area of our life. We try our best to be obedient to Him with all of our decisions. We pray together often and it is very helpful. Another important thing, is keeping away from old crowds and temptations. We have made a conscience effort to surround ourselves with people we aspire to be like. We spend our time with people who love us unconditionally, yet hold us accountable. We found a wonderful church with unbelievable people there that have become our new friends. They want to see us grow in every area of our lives and be successful, as opposed to just wanting us to hangout with them and do the same stuff we always have. As Jim Rohn said, “You are the average of the five people that you spend the most time with.” So spending time with old friends who have the same habits would be sure to lead you right back where you started. The definition of insanity is “to do the same thing over and over and expecting different results.” We did not like the results from the way we were living, so we changed things and gave it God.
